China Promotes Blockchain for Environmental Governance

On December 25, 2023, China's Ministry of Ecology and Environment highlighted the role of blockchain technology in advancing ecological governance. This announcement came during a cybersecurity and infrastructure meeting chaired by Secretary Sun Jinlong, showcasing the country's commitment to integrating innovative technologies for sustainable development. Based on the data provided in the document, the integration of blockchain is expected to enhance transparency and efficiency in environmental management.

Blockchain Initiative for Ecological Governance

The initiative aims to leverage blockchain's capabilities to improve transparency and efficiency in ecological governance, aligning with China's broader sustainability goals set for 2025.

Market Reaction and Technological Integration

While the announcement marks a significant step towards technological integration in environmental management, it did not trigger any immediate reactions in the cryptocurrency market. This reflects a cautious approach as the ministry seeks to balance technological advancement with ecological responsibility.
